diff --git a/_docs/60_account/35_okta-saml-sso.md b/_docs/60_account/35_okta-saml-sso.md new file mode 100644 index 0000000..418cb99 --- /dev/null +++ b/_docs/60_account/35_okta-saml-sso.md @@ -0,0 +1,71 @@ +--- +title: Set up Okta SAML SSO +category: account +permalink: /okta-saml-sso +last_modified_at: 2026-06-16 +--- + +Use this guide to connect Okta to your Simple Analytics team with SAML SSO. + +Before you start, make sure you have admin access in Okta and access to the [team settings](https://dashboard.simpleanalytics.com/settings/team) in Simple Analytics. If you do not see the SSO settings in Simple Analytics yet, [contact us](https://dashboard.simpleanalytics.com/contact) and ask us to enable SSO setup for your team. + +## 1. Create a Simple Analytics account (if you don't have one) + +Create a Simple Analytics account if you do not have one yet. You need access to a team before you can connect Okta. + +## 2. Create the Okta application + +In Okta, create a new application integration and select **SAML 2.0** as the sign-in method. + +Use these settings for the application: + +1. Set the app name to **Simple Analytics**. +1. Optionally, add the Simple Analytics logo from our [media kit](https://www.simpleanalytics.com/media-kit). +1. For **Single sign-on URL**, use the SSO URL shown in the SSO section of your Simple Analytics [team settings](https://dashboard.simpleanalytics.com/settings/team). +1. Keep **Use this for Recipient URL and Destination URL** checked. +1. For **Audience URI**, use the SP Entity ID shown in the SSO section of your Simple Analytics [team settings](https://dashboard.simpleanalytics.com/settings/team). +1. Leave **Default RelayState** empty. +1. Set **Name ID format** to **EmailAddress**. +1. Set **Application username** to **Email**. +1. Set **Update application username on** to **Create and update**. + +Save the Okta application when you are done. + +## 3. Add Okta details to Simple Analytics + +In Okta, open the **Sign On** tab for the Simple Analytics application and click **View SAML setup instructions**. + +Then go to your Simple Analytics [team settings](https://dashboard.simpleanalytics.com/settings/team) and fill in the SSO setup form: + +1. For **Your domain(s)**, enter the email domain your team uses for SSO. For example, if your users sign in with addresses like `name@example.com`, enter `example.com`. +1. For **Identity Provider Single Sign-On URL**, copy the URL from Okta's setup instructions. +1. For **Identity Provider Issuer / Entity ID**, copy the issuer from Okta's setup instructions. +1. For **Signing certificate**, copy the X.509 certificate from Okta's setup instructions. +1. Leave the attribute mapping fields unchanged if you used the Okta settings from this guide. +1. Click **Save SSO draft**. + +Your Single sign-on status should now show **Draft**. + +## 4. Ask us to confirm the setup + +After saving the draft, [contact us](https://dashboard.simpleanalytics.com/contact) and let us know your Okta settings are ready for confirmation. + +We will check the setup and let you know when it is ready to test. + +## 5. Test SSO login + +Once we confirm the setup, test logging in from the Simple Analytics application in your Okta dashboard. + +You can also use the SSO login link shown in the SSO section of your Simple Analytics [team settings](https://dashboard.simpleanalytics.com/settings/team). + +When the login works, let us know if you want SSO to be required for your team. + +## 6. Add team members + +To add more people to your team: + +1. Assign them to the Simple Analytics application in Okta. +1. Invite them from your Simple Analytics [team settings](https://dashboard.simpleanalytics.com/settings/team). +1. Ask them to log in through Okta. + +After they log in, they can accept the invitation and join your Simple Analytics team.
